Newly revised and updated edition. Over 75,000 copies sold! For nearly two decades, Lord, Bless My Child has provided an enduring power of prayer for families. With a template to guide parents in praying for the character of God to be developed in the lives of their children, this book offers 52 prayer concepts that fall in line with God's plan for each child. Included are scriptures, prayers, age-old quotes, and discussion questions for family interaction. There is also a place to journal the prayers-and later, how God has answered. When the child leaves home, many parents give this journal to their child as a gift so they can read the prayer journal entries, and see how God answered their parent's prayers over the years. The popular mother-daughter team behind the hit website TheCatholicCatalogue.com helps readers to discover, rediscover, and embrace the holidays and seasons of Catholic life through this collection of prayers, crafts, devotionals and recipes. This beautifully designed book will help readers celebrate Catholicism throughout the years, across daily practice and milestones. The Catholic Catalogue is a field guide, a list of far ranging topics, that should aid any Catholic, whether steeped in the tradition or just discovering spirituality for the first time, to understand the daily acts that make up a Catholic life. And like the most useful field guides, it is divided into user-friendly sections and covers such topics as the veneration of relics, blessing your house, discovering a vocation, raising teenagers, getting a Catholic tattoo, planting a Mary garden, finding a spiritual director, and exploring your own way in the tradition.
